[quote=Anonymous]Clifton, Herndon, and Vienna are incorporated towns within Fairfax County. Fairfax City is a Class-2 city within Fairfax County. Falls Church City is a Class-2 city within Arlington County. Alexandria City is a Class-1 city, so it has its own Circuit Court. A Class-2 city in VA does not have its own Circuit Court and instead uses the Circuit Court associated with the County. Any incorporated city (but not town) in VA is allowed to have its own public school system. Falls Church City does have its own FCCPS. Fairfax City (for now) instead has contracted with Fairfax County for its public schools. Annandale, Chantilly, McLean, and Reston all are examples of Census-designated (and USPS designated) places. What makes things somewhat confusing here is that the Post Office does not align postal boundaries with incorporated city/town boundaries. This means, for example, that a postal address of Vienna might or might not be within the Town of Vienna.[/quote]
